There's no shortage of apps out there that can help you do this-from those that came pre-installed on your computer, to free and paid apps like Squoosh and Adobe Suite. One easy way to address most of these issues is to reduce your photos' file sizes before uploading them to your website and embed them into your post. However, it also makes your pages load more slowly-especially for people on slow Internet connections-can require more system resources from your readers' computers and mobile devices, and can be inaccessible to some with visual impairments.
